Mahnomen Health Center

414 WEST JEFFERSON AVENUE, MAHNOMEN, MN 56557
Score: 74 / 100

Mahnomen Health Center earns a solid B grade from CMS data, with a score of 74/100. Performing above average across most metrics, this Mahnomen facility ranks in the 64th percentile among Minnesota nursing homes.

Staffing levels at Mahnomen Health Center exceed national averages, with 5.62 total nursing hours per resident per day — compared to the national average of 3.8 hours. RN coverage of 1.41 hours per resident per day also exceeds the national average of 0.7 hours.

Recent inspections identified 11 deficiencies at Mahnomen Health Center.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

How This Grade Was Calculated

This facility's grade of B is based on a score of 74 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:

  • Overall CMS Rating: 4★ → 32 pts (max 40)
  • Health Inspection Rating: 4★ → 20 pts (max 25)
  • Staffing Rating: 4★ → 16 pts (max 20)
  • Quality Measures Rating: 4★ → 12 pts (max 15)
  • Penalty deductions: -5 pts
  • Fine deductions: -1 pts

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
